Thanks for this video. I still can't find how to make the articulation legato in the string section without having to write slurs everywhere. Separated notes sound staccato.
@ilkayboraoder
@ilkayboraoder 3 жыл бұрын
Hi, you're welcome and there are actually 2 options to do so. 1 you can write "legato" with technique text entry. Or you can use tenuto always Plugin which is installed with Noteperformer. N. B. If you use legato text remember to not use slurs for that particolar passage. And to return normal write non legato.

Hi ilkay, noob question, about the fortissimo dynamics in the Brass section, Doesn't Noteperformer balance well this kind of things? I mean, How can I trust Noteperformer play the right way in a balance way in the entire orchestra? Or the example you've shown is only because you want the real player play louder? I'm curious about this. Thanks in advance, good job!
@ilkayboraoder
@ilkayboraoder 4 жыл бұрын
Hi, nice question, Yeap Noteperformer is very accurate and trustable. And I can confirm with many personal experience comparing with real orchestra performances. However this example is about the numbers. Np is a middle sized orchestra with 8-8-6-6-4 strings size (as Ravel's indication on his piano concerto) So! If you write mostly for this dimension of an orchestra you do not need to manupulate any further dynamics (Almost) - (You'll see it at my upcoming example - stay in tune). But if you change the dimension you have to boost the size and sounds kinda. Because 4 horns will sound much more different between 60 strings than between 30 strings. Hope this answers your question.

Hi, I am trying to write flamenco guitar, but notepeformer cannot playback guitar strumming realistically. Is there any way? Thanks!
@ilkayboraoder
@ilkayboraoder 3 жыл бұрын
Hi Arya, yes, there is a Strummer Plugin, I didn't have a chapter for that yet but you can read the manual to understand how does it work. Trust me it changes allllll the guitar sounding regard strums
@aryaadami
@aryaadami 3 жыл бұрын
@@ilkayboraoder Do you mean the "Alternate Picking" guitar plugin?
@ilkayboraoder
@ilkayboraoder 3 жыл бұрын
Nope I mean the Strummer plugin which shipped with Sibelius. You can find it on Play Tab (Ribbon) > Plugins > Strummer. Or write it directly to "Find in Ribbon" as Strummer Plugin. It's a very funny one, You have to precise Down or Up strokes for each chords. Reach me out on Facebook, I'll send you a little demonstration video in case you can't resolve it.
